Does Mayo remove heat stains on wood?

mayo It might sound strange, but the ingredients in mayonnaise can remove heat rings and stains. Simply apply mayonnaise to the affected area and leave it on overnight. Wipe it off the next morning and the marks should be gone.

Can you fix heat marks on wood?

After cleaning the table, try using a mixture of toothpaste and baking soda first. Mix 1 tablespoon (approx. 20ml) toothpaste with 2 tablespoons baking soda (40ml) in a small bowl to form a sticky white paste. Rub the paste into the heat mark in the direction of the wood grain.

How do I remove white stains from wooden tables?

Get rid of those white stains caused by hot mugs or sweaty glasses from your coffee table or other wooden furniture by making a paste of 1 tablespoon baking soda and 1 teaspoon water. Gently rub the stain in a circular motion until it disappears. Remember not to use too much water to remove water stains from wood. 12
